Analysis

The most recent figure for equal rights protection index in Singapore is 0.858, measured in 2025. That is the highest value across all 159 years on record.

The figure is up 0.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, equal rights protection index in Singapore peaked at 0.858 in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0.205, in 1946.

Singapore ranks 27th of 176 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 159 years of available data.
